Just in: Buhari, Buni, Ganduje meet in Aso Rock

President Muhammadu Buhari

By Johnbosco Agbakwuru

President Muhammadu Buhari on Monday met behind closed doors with the Caretaker Committee of the All Progressives Congress, APC, Mai Mala Buni and Governor Abdallah Ganduje of Kano State at the Presidential Villa, Abuja.

Governor Ganduje was Chairman of the APC Campaign Committee for the just concluded Edo governorship election which was won by the incumbent governor Godwin Obaseki of the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P against Pastor Osagie Ize-Iyamu, the party’s standard bearer.

Although the meeting was described as private, it may not be unconnected to the Edo governorship election.

READ ALSO: Edo Poll: APC supporters commend Buhari for providing level playing field

The APC Caretaker Committee Chairman, who is also the governor of Yobe State and Ganduje were seen departing the president’s office using a route to deliberately avoid State House reporters.

Recall that Ganduje and his Imo state counterpart, Hope Uzodinma, spent the weekend in Benin City as they hoped to oversee the victory of the APC in the poll.

Bill Gates, bogeyman of virus conspiracy theorists

                    Bill Gates False claims targeting billionaire philanthropist Bill Gates are gaining traction online since the beginning of the coronavirus outbreak, with experts warning they could hamper efforts to curb the virus. Doctored photos and fabricated news articles crafted by conspiracy theorists — shared thousands of times on social media platforms and messaging apps, in various languages — have gone as far as accusing the Microsoft founder of creating the outbreak. Gates, who has pledged $250 million to efforts to fight the pandemic, is the latest in a string of online targets despite the World Health Organization’s efforts to fight what it called an “infodemic” — misinformation fanned by panic and confusion about the virus.
